Flan Recipe


5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

No reviews

Description

A classic Flan that is rich, creamy, and topped with a silky caramel layer, perfect for any occasion.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ar (for caramel)
  • 1/4 cup water (for caramel)
  • 14 oz can sweetened condensed milk
  • 12 oz can evaporated milk
  • 1 3/4 cups heavy whipping cream
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ons vanilla extract
  • 5 large eggs (room temperature)
  • 1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t
  • Optional: 1 teaspoon finely grated orange zest or 1–2 tablespoons instant espresso

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a hot water bath.
  2. In a saucepan, combine the sugar and water. Heat to dissolve, then cook until golden amber for caramel.
  3. Pour caramel into a non-stick cake pan and let cool.
  4. Blend the condensed milk, evaporated milk, cream, vanilla, eggs, and salt until smooth.
  5. Strain the mixture, if desired, and pour over the cooled caramel.
  6. Cover the pan with foil and place in a roasting pan filled with hot water halfway up the sides.
  7. Bake for 70–80 minutes until just set in the center.
  8. Cool on a wire rack and refrigerate overnight.
  9. To unmold, run a knife around the edges, invert onto a platter, and serve.

  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cook Time: 80 minutes
  • Category: Dessert
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: Mexican
